Looking for a sedan trunk leaf guard 900

To fix the front leaf guard, I removed it from the sticky goo holding it in place in the cowl. I then sandwiched fibreglass window screen between the cowl grill and the screen below and reinstalled using new butyl rubber tape, reinforced by small zip ties threaded through and tied to the cowl grill. The window screen has very small openings that prevent seeds, needles and leaf parts from dropping through and allows you to vacuum off the top of the cowl very easily.
The rear trunk lid gap? I have no clue how to fix this. Maybe some kind of stiff plastic tape applied to the underside of the trunk lid might cover the gap.
